ashore
adv. 上岸; 到陸地上
Someone or something that comes ashore comes from the sea onto the shore.
Oil has come ashore on a ten mile stretch to the east of Plymouth...
綿延10英里的浮油已經到達了普利茅斯東岸。
Once ashore, the vessel was thoroughly inspected.
船隻剛一靠岸就接受了徹底檢查。
